Limitations

Giving limited to CO.
No support for organizations that distribute funds to other grantees, religious or political organizations, primary or secondary education, or for camps or seasonal facilities.
No grants to individuals, or for travel, film or other media projects, conferences, seminars, deficit financing, endowment funds, research.

Summary

Grants only to nonprofit organizations for public, educational, arts and humanities, health, and welfare purposes, including child welfare, the disadvantaged, and housing; municipalities may request funds for specific projects.
